Design types of cabinets for storing dishes in the kitchen

Based on the type of construction, kitchen cabinets are divided into three main types:

  • floor,
  • mounted,
  • corner.

The design determines the technical characteristics and functionality of the furniture, so before choosing a cabinet for dishes in the kitchen, you should properly plan the space, take into account the geometric features and style of the room, and decide on the main purpose of the module.

Floor-standing models of kitchen cabinets for dishes

The range of floor-standing kitchen cabinets combines a wide variety of modifications, including display cabinets, pencil cases and low cabinets. The furniture is based on supporting legs or a plinth. Structures installed on the floor are characterized by greater capacity and functionality. In addition to serving as storage, low floor cabinets also act as an additional work surface.

Floor-standing models of kitchen furniture are a durable and reliable storage system that can withstand significant loads. Floor-standing modules store a wide variety of household utensils - pots and pans, bowls, plates, cups, etc.

Mounted models

Wall cabinets are an alternative to bulky floor cabinets. Kitchen hanging modules are hung on the wall and do not take up floor space, while at the same time they have quite good capacity. Compact wall cabinets are the optimal solution for kitchens with modest square footage.

Due to their design features, wall-mounted modules are not used for storing heavy and large kitchen utensils. Plates, mugs and glasses, jars of spices and other small accessories are placed on the shelves of the cabinet.

Corner kitchen cabinets for utensils

The main advantages of corner models are ergonomics and functionality. The design of the kitchen cabinet allows you to effectively use the corner area, while the depth of the module significantly exceeds the standard parameters of linear models. The non-standard depth of the furniture allows you to fit a large number of household items used in the kitchen.

Corner modules for dishes can be presented in the form of a wall or floor cabinet, as well as a column cabinet. Based on the shape of the body, corner structures are divided into:

  • for trapezoidal ones - a trapezoid-shaped cabinet. The pentagonal design is characterized by an original appearance, spacious internal volume and quite impressive dimensions. Trapezoid cabinets are not recommended for storing dishes in small kitchens;
  • L-shaped - consists of two parts located perpendicular to each other. The joining of the corner structure with the straight elements of the headset is carried out using the end parts. The L-shaped cabinet fits perfectly into the corner, accurately repeating its configuration;
  • docking - a straight cabinet, one of the parts of which has a blank facade. The blank panel serves as a platform for connecting the linear module of the kitchen set. Furniture items are joined at an angle of 900.

Types of dish storage systems for kitchen cabinets

Many housewives wonder about the optimal arrangement of numerous utensils inside kitchen furniture. You can increase the ease of use and capacity of the cabinet by wisely selecting the internal contents. The furniture market offers a wide selection of storage systems for dishes.

Plate storage systems

Shelves are mainly used to store plates. Shelves can be solid or lattice. In the first option, the plates are stored in stacks, in the second, they are stored in the “edge” position.

Often, wall cabinets for dishes are equipped with dryers. The dryer is a metal lattice structure into which the plates are installed end-to-end. An integral element of the drying cabinet is a tray for collecting drainage water.

In addition to standard shelves, floor cabinets can be equipped with drawers, the internal space of which is divided into separate compartments using special dividers. Dividers protect dishes from hitting each other when drawers are pulled out.

Storage systems for mugs in kitchen cabinets

Cups, glasses and glasses are usually stored in the top row of the kitchen unit. To place cups, shelves are used on which tableware is arranged in a row or in stacks.

A popular way to store mugs is to use railing systems. The railing is a suspended pipe structure equipped with special holders.

Hooks built into the top surface of the cupboard can be used to store cups.

In floor structures, drawers with dividers are used to store mugs.

For pots

Pots are placed in the lower tier of the kitchen unit. Stationary and retractable shelves and deep drawers are used to store kitchen equipment. To equip a corner module, it is better to choose a rotating carousel or a retractable “magic corner” system.

The carousel shelf is a vertical axis on which semicircular rotating shelves are fixed. The stationary frame is mounted inside the corner module.

“Magic Corner” is a storage system consisting of several rectangular shelves connected to each other according to the “train” principle. The first row of shelves is fixed on the inside of the facade; when the doors are opened, the compartments slide out one after another, providing access to the contents.

For frying pans

The following types of storage systems are used to arrange pans inside the kitchen module:

  • shelves;
  • roof rails;
  • drawers with dividers.

To organize the storage of frying pans and saucepans, a retractable system can be used, made in the form of a platform, moved along guides and equipped with hooks for hanging kitchen utensils.

Floor cabinets for dishes are equipped with shelves and drawers for frying pans. Railing systems allow you to organize inventory storage in both floor and wall modules.

For lids

The lids of pots, saucepans and frying pans can be stored together with kitchen devices, or have their own separate location.

To place lids in the lower kitchen module, drawers are used, the internal space of which is divided into compartments using a special grid.

For convenient storage of lids from frying pans and pots on shelves, use special stands. As a rule, stands are a separate plastic box installed inside a floor cabinet. Improved designs are equipped with a retractable system.

To optimize the storage space for lids, you can use the inside of the cabinet front. The market offers a huge range of railing systems for storing lids - mesh baskets, lattices, pipe structures, hooks.

Manufacturing materials

Modern manufacturers of living room cupboards use various materials to make them. The price range is also varied, each buyer will be able to choose furniture according to their preferences and financial capabilities:

  • solid natural wood (oak, walnut, pine, hardwood) is an invariably popular material, the most expensive and durable, has a durable shape, the finished product will last for many years;
  • MDF is practically indistinguishable from its wooden counterpart, the furniture looks chic and costs much less;
  • Chipboard is a relatively inexpensive, but far from the best material; it can delaminate when exposed to moisture; also, the cupboard is made of varnished chipboard to protect it from an aggressive environment and give the product a shiny appearance;
  • veneer – thin sheets of solid wood are glued onto a chipboard board;
  • plastic – practical, easy to care for, resistant to moisture, mechanical stress, used less often in the production of china cabinets, usually as an attribute of modern design;
  • glass (including tinted, colored, mirrors) – used for the manufacture of cabinet facades or their elements.

Selection rules

First of all, the choice of a cupboard for the living room depends on the overall style of the most important room in the house. Here the family gathers in the evenings, relax, receive dear guests, while the living room should impress the guests, demonstrating the good taste of the owners.

For a living room decorated in a classic, modern, or retro style, a good-quality sideboard or cabinet made of solid wood, the front panel of which consists of many windows separated by wooden slats, is suitable. Expensive fittings and decoration will emphasize the status of the owner. The minimalist style is determined by the simplicity and laconicism of each piece of furniture, so light, transparent glass display cases of simple geometric shapes will look organic here, making the surrounding space open and airy.

Since one of the main elements of cupboards is glass facades, it is important to pay attention to the thickness (at least 5 mm) and quality of the glass. It is recommended to purchase products made from tempered, impact-resistant material; even if such glass is broken (which is not easy), its fragments will not scatter throughout the room and will remain safe. All fasteners, retractable mechanisms, and fittings must be strong and reliable.
